Power Connection System Is Shrouded

Feb. 1, 2001

The company's Power Connection System products now include a safety shroud feature. The male contacts are shrouded for safety against contact with high voltage when the connector system is disconnected. The safety shroud helps provide a high reliability connector with integral locking system.
The firm's Power Connection System products offer many contact variants, termination styles, and accessories. Now available are options that include size 12 contacts that are capable of supporting 40A per contact and are hot-pluggable to 25A per contact at 250 Vac. The connectors have a large mating surface area. And the three contact variant of the interconnect system is suited as an ac or dc input connector.
